Latest Patents

Yi-Hong Chen's latest patents include a safety power socket device and a safety power socket device with remote monitor management. The safety power socket device features a housing with a depositing space, a power plug, a temperature sensor module, a power supply module, a transformer rectifier, a charging battery, an illumination module, and a power failure switch module. This device is designed to prevent high temperatures and potential electric fires by cutting off power supply when necessary. Additionally, the embedded illumination module enhances home safety protection. His other patent involves compounds for organic thin-film solar cells, which are designed to improve power conversion efficiency through unique molecular design.
